Web1 nov. 2013 · The megathrust fault between the underthrusting Cocos plate and overriding Caribbean plate recently experienced three large ruptures: the August 27, 2012 (M w 7.3) El Salvador; September 5, 2012 (M w 7.6) Costa Rica; and November 7, 2012 (M w 7.4) Guatemala earthquakes. WebThe Sunda megathrust is a fault that extends approximately 5,500 km (3300 mi) from Myanmar (Burma) in the north, running along the southwestern side of Sumatra, to the south of Java and Bali before terminating near Australia.
